These pins should be left
unconnected
Master clear (RESET) input. This pin is
an active low RESET to the device.
Programming voltage input
Oscillator crystal input or external
clock source input. ST buffer when
configured in RC mode. Otherwise
CMOS.
External clock source input. Always
associated with pin function OSC1
(see OSC1/CLKI, OSC2/CLKO pins).
Oscillator crystal output.
Connects to crystal or resonator in
Crystal Oscillator mode.
In RC mode, OSC2 pin outputs CLKO,
which has 1/4 the frequency of OSC1
and denotes the instruction cycle rate
General purpose I/O pin
